系统分析师必备:UML实战指南解决需求难题

需积分: 0 0 下载量 129 浏览量 更新于2024-07-30 收藏 4.97MB PDF 举报
系统分析师UML实务手册.pdf是一本针对系统分析师的重要参考书籍,它强调了在现代IT项目中,掌握统一建模语言(UML)的重要性。UML作为一种国际标准,旨在促进面向对象分析和设计的沟通,尤其是在C++、Java等面向对象编程语言日益普及的情况下,UML成为了设计师与开发者之间转换需求和设计的关键桥梁。 系统分析师的角色至关重要,他们不仅要理解并整理用户的需求,还要将这些需求准确无误地传达给开发团队。在过去的实践中,非面向对象的需求文件直接转化为UML图往往存在效率低下和错误频繁的问题。为了克服这些挑战,越来越多的公司开始倡导系统分析师学习OO理念和熟练运用UML,以确保整个开发过程中的需求一致性,从分析阶段开始,贯穿于设计和实现阶段,减少沟通误解。 虽然UML被寄予厚望,认为它能够提高需求理解和减少变更,但实际上,UML并不能完全消除误解或防止需求变更,因为这是人类沟通固有的难题,加上专业背景差异,误解在所难免。然而,这并不意味着UML无用武之地。通过选择合适的UML工具,如付费或免费的图形化工具,系统分析师可以提升工作效率,生成的UML文档便于设计师添加详细设计,进而指导程序员按照图示进行编码。 系统分析师UML实务手册.pdf不仅介绍了UML的基础知识,还深入探讨了如何有效利用UML来改善项目管理,包括需求收集、转化和沟通,以及如何处理可能出现的问题,帮助读者提升在系统分析领域的实践能力。学习和掌握UML是系统分析师在现代IT项目中不可或缺的一项技能。